Title: can't change SMTP server to non-default for an identity Status in thunderbird package in Ubuntu: Incomplete Bug description: Binary package hint: thunderbird Ubuntu 9.04 ThunderBird 2.0.0.23+build1+nobinonly-0ubuntu0.9.04.1 I have a single account created in TB but have multiple SMTP accounts. I created new identities for these SMTP servers, however when I tried to change the SMTP server for what was the original identity to a non- default SMTP server, it would allow me to save but did not actually store the change. Every time I checked the identity settings again, it had reverted to the default SMTP server. I eventually overcame this bug by completely deleting that identity and recreating it from scratch.
